Transaction 45764b492c2fa0b677bd3bb995e8e1731f18761bf719a8cf2af02eceab6d908c

32 Input
2 Outputs
  • 45764b492c2fa0b677bd3bb995e8e1731f18761bf719a8cf2af02eceab6d908c:0
  • value  863008860
    address  18yHBAqyWvMeGYNo333ManLE9ueJgrLjjT
  • 45764b492c2fa0b677bd3bb995e8e1731f18761bf719a8cf2af02eceab6d908c:1
  • value  617367
    address  1Ect2jDHmV2PakbRwjpMS8CfNeNBek7keD